About Zip Code 95521

95521 is a zip code in the Eureka Metropolitan area. It has a population of 21,712 and a population density of 395, which is 76% above the national average. It has a median age of 28, which is 10 years below the Eureka Metro median age and 11 years below the national average.


Zip code 95521 has a median home value of $505,238, which is 38% above the Metro average.The average rent of $1,025 is 4% above the metro average rent and 51% below the national average rent The average household income in zip code 95521 is $47,764 , which is 13% below the Metro average household income and 36% below the national average of household income.

Zip code 95521's population is made up of 24% married, 63% single, 10% divorced and 3% widowed. Millennials make up the largest percentage of the population at 44%, while Baby Boomers have the second largest segment at 25%. Homeowners make up 37% of the population in zip code 95521.

Arcata crime index is 137 which is higher than the national average.

137
Crime Index
100
National Crime Index

Crime Index represents the risk of crime occurring in a area and is measured against national index of 100. If the Crime Index of an area is above 100 the crime in that area is relatively higher when compared to US. If the Crime Index of an area is below 100 the crime in that area is lower when compared to US.
